Hospital Pharmacy Technician needed to start ASAP in Boston, Lincolnshire.**

Location: Boston, Lincolnshire.

Contract Duration: 6+ months

Working Hours: Monday - Friday, 9:00 AM - 5:00 PM

Hourly Rate: Up to £25.00 per hour

Job Description:

Trident Healthcare are seeking a dedicated and experienced Hospital Pharmacy Technician to join our clients team on a locum contract for a minimum of 6 months. This is an excellent opportunity to work in a dynamic and supportive NHS environment, providing essential pharmaceutical services to patients.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Prepare and dispense medications under the supervision of a licensed pharmacist.

  • Manage and maintain accurate patient medication records.

  • Assist in the procurement and management of pharmaceutical supplies.

  • Provide medication counseling and support to patients and healthcare professionals.

  • Ensure compliance with all relevant regulations and standards.

    Requirements:

  • Qualified Pharmacy Technician with relevant certification.

  • Previous experience in a hospital pharmacy setting is preferred.

  • Strong attention to detail and excellent organizational skills.

  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.

  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.

    Benefits:

  • Competitive hourly rate up to £25.00.

  • Opportunity to gain valuable experience in a hospital setting.

  • Supportive and collaborative work environment.
